#19595: Implement a check that a hyperplane arrangement is free
-------------------------------------+-------------------------------------
       Reporter:  tscrim             |        Owner:  tscrim
           Type:  enhancement        |       Status:  needs_review
       Priority:  major              |    Milestone:  sage-7.0
      Component:  geometry           |   Resolution:
       Keywords:  free, hyperplane   |    Merged in:
  arrangement                        |    Reviewers:
        Authors:  Travis Scrimshaw   |  Work issues:
Report Upstream:  N/A                |       Commit:
         Branch:                     |  05d7517656a9d911f6d97cc875bd82afb9f30f07
  public/hyperplanes/check_free-19595|     Stopgaps:
   Dependencies:                     |
-------------------------------------+-------------------------------------

Comment (by tscrim):

 Replying to [comment:6 tscrim]:
 > Replying to [comment:4 chapoton]:
 > > * do you check for "freeness" or some stronger "inductive freeness" ?
 >
 > As I understand it, this is just freeness, but I will make a detailed
 reading and double-check this.

 This does not check inductive freeness because it does not check both the
 exponent condition and the freeness of the restriction. However this would
 make for a good followup.

 > > * in `to_symmetric_space`
 > > {{{
 > > return S.sum(G[i]*c for i,c in enumerate(self.coefficients()[1:]))
 > > }}}
 > > why is there `[1:]` ?
 >
 > Because the first coefficient of a hyperplane is the constant part (as
 the arrangements do not need to be central, i.e., they are allowed to be
 affine hyperplanes).

 In my recent push, I now forbid affine hyperplanes since I don't believe
 they make sense in the symmetric space.

 > > * maybe you should rather write
 > > {{{chordality is equivalent to freeness}}}
 > > and name the files "`check_freeness`"
 >
 > Will change.

 Done.

--
Ticket URL: <http://trac.sagemath.org/ticket/19595#comment:8>
Sage <http://www.sagemath.org>
Sage: Creating a Viable Open Source Alternative to Magma, Maple, Mathematica, 
and MATLAB

-- 
You received this message because you are subscribed to the Google Groups 
"sage-trac"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at https://groups.google.com/group/sage-trac.
For more options, visit https://groups.google.com/d/optout.

Reply via email to